Packed with bold flavors and nutritious ingredients, this High Protein Spicy Beef Stir-Fry is the perfect quick and healthy dinner choice. Featuring tender, marinated beef flank steak, crisp broccoli, colorful bell peppers, and a fiery blend of Sriracha, hoisin, and oyster sauces, this dish combines high-protein content with vibrant vegetables for a balanced meal. Enhanced with aromatic garlic, fresh ginger, and the crunch of optional roasted cashews, this stir-fry comes together in just 30 minutes, making it an ideal weeknight go-to. Serve it over steamed rice, quinoa, or even cauliflower rice for a customizable feast that delivers on taste and nutrition. Whether you're meal-prepping or enjoying it fresh, this recipe is a tantalizing way to spice up your protein-packed dinner repertoire.
Scan with your phone to download!
Thinly slice the beef flank steak against the grain into bite-sized strips. Place the strips in a bowl and combine with 2 tablespoons of soy sauce and 2 tablespoons of cornstarch. Mix well, cover, and let marinate for 10 minutes.
In a small bowl, whisk together the remaining 1 tablespoon of soy sauce, hoisin sauce, oyster sauce, Sriracha sauce, water, and 1 tablespoon of sesame oil. Set the sauce aside.
Heat 1 tablespoon of vegetable oil in a large skillet or wok over medium-high heat. Once hot, add the marinated beef in a single layer and cook for 2-3 minutes on each side until browned and cooked through. Remove the beef from the skillet and set aside.
In the same skillet, add the remaining 1 tablespoon of vegetable oil. Add the minced garlic, ginger, and crushed red pepper flakes. Stir-fry for 30 seconds until fragrant.
Add the broccoli florets, sliced bell peppers, carrots, and half of the green onions to the skillet. Stir-fry for 3-4 minutes until the vegetables are tender-crisp.
Return the cooked beef to the skillet and pour in the sauce mixture. Toss everything together to coat evenly and allow the sauce to thicken for 1-2 minutes.
Remove from heat and drizzle with the remaining 1 tablespoon of sesame oil. Garnish with the remaining green onions and roasted cashews, if using.
Serve the stir-fry hot over steamed rice, quinoa, or cauliflower rice for a complete meal.
Serving size | (1351.9g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2084.9 |
Total Fat 124.4g | 0% |
Saturated Fat 31.0g | 0% |
Polyunsaturated Fat 29.0g | |
Cholesterol 351.0mg | 0% |
Sodium 3195.4mg | 0% |
Total Carbohydrate 92.7g | 0% |
Dietary Fiber 16.5g | 0% |
Total Sugars 30.5g | |
Protein 164.2g | 0% |
Vitamin D 0IU | 0% |
Calcium 295.3mg | 0% |
Iron 22.4mg | 0% |
Potassium 2956.6mg | 0% |
Source of Calories